Snapchat Selfie Solves Teenage Murder in Pennsylvania

Photo Credit: Tribune-Review A selfie photograph led police to charge a teenager in connection with the Wednesday shooting death of another teen in Jeannette, according to authorities.

Westmoreland County District Attorney John Peck confirmed late Friday night that Maxwell Morton, 16, was charged as an adult in the shooting death of Ryan Mangan.

The alleged selfie obtained by police showed Morton posing in front of Mangan’s body. A woman contacted police Thursday after her son received the Snapchat photo from Morton, police said . . .

The selfie “depicted the victim sitting in the chair with a gunshot wound to the face,” according to a police affidavit. “It also depicts a black male taking the selfie with his face facing the camera and the victim behind the actor. The photo had the name ‘Maxwell’ across the top” . . .

Morton is charged with criminal homicide and murder in the first degree, in addition to one count of possession of a firearm by a minor, according to court documents. He was denied bail Friday night. (Read more about the teenage murder in Pennsylvania HERE)

Alaska Conservationists Concerned With Cruise Ship Rules

Photo Credit: APTowering cruise ships, sometimes four at a time, sit at port in Juneau at the peak of summer, delivering tourists important to the economy of this and other southeast Alaska communities. But some conservationists worry about what the ships could be leaving in Alaska waters and are fighting proposed new rules for the discharge of treated wastewater . . .

Over the years, Alaska has rolled back provisions of a 2006 citizen initiative that called for cruise ship wastewater to meet water quality standards at the point of discharge. In 2013, for example, the Legislature struck that discharge requirement, saying instead that wastewater cannot be discharged in a way that violates applicable state or federal law.

The 2013 law allowed for mixing zones, where wastewater can be diluted into the water, if ships meet certain standards for treatment of discharge. The change followed a debated preliminary report from a science advisory panel that found none of the advanced wastewater treatment systems on ships operating in Alaska waters could consistently meet water quality standards at the point of discharge for four “constituents of concern:” ammonia, copper, nickel and zinc.

The proposed general permit, under which ships can apply to be covered, are based on that law. (Read more about the concerns from the Alaska conservationists HERE)

Obama Admin. Rewarding Illegal Aliens with Tens of Thousands in Earned Income Tax Credits

By Daniel Halper. President Barack Obama has promoted his recent executive action on immigration by arguing that he’s only deferring action – holding off on enforcement of the current immigration laws until an immigration reform he approves of passes Congress. But that’s not really true; in fact there’s a way for illegal immigrants immediately to receive “amnesty bonuses,” as Senator Ben Sasse of Nebraska terms it.

Here’s how. A recent Homeland Security Committee hearing on immigration revealed an alarming consequence of President Obama’s executive amnesty—that illegal immigrants with deferred status may be able to receive the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C). Moreover, this person, who is here in the U.S. unlawfully, could be able to file an amended tax return for up to the last three tax years, possibly receiving upwards of $24,000 in tax credits.

The discovery was made by Eileen J. O’Connor, a tax lawyer and the former head of the tax division of the United States Department of Justice, who used her congressional testimony in front of the Senate Homeland Security Committee to explain it. “The law makes a social security number a requirement of eligibility to receive the earned income credit,” O’Connor explained.

“But in 1999, the Chief Counsel’s office of IRS ruled (in a non-binding, non-precedential way, but no one but the IRS pays attention to those disclaimers) that when a person receives a social security number, he can file amended returns to claim the credit for the three preceding years during which he did not. The logic is puzzling: the credit is not available if you don’t have a social security number, but you can receive it retroactively for years during which you did not qualify for it because you didn’t have a social security number.”

Senator Sasse, who along with Senator Ron Johnson has written a letter addressed to the inspector general of the U.S. Treasury Department, has released a statement commenting on the “amnesty bonuses.” (Read more about Obama rewarding illegal aliens HERE)

Corruption: Seven Congressmen (Including Mark Begich) Who Joined Lobbying Firms Less Than a Month After Leaving Office

Less than a month after leaving office, at least five former House members and one U.S. senator are already on the payroll at firms that make millions lobbying their congressional colleagues. The findings, provided to Vocativ by the Center for Responsive Politics, a government watchdog group, also show that a second senator who left office at the beginning of January, Alaska’s Mark Begich, took the extra step of starting his own public affairs consulting firm, which has already secured clients in health care and aviation.

While Washington’s contentious revolving door spins in perpetuum—allowing a stream of money, influence and access to flow seamlessly between the private and public sectors—the speed with which these public servants have offered themselves up to big business may raise a few eyebrows . . .

By law, ex-House members are required to wait one year before they can officially lobby lawmakers on the Hill, while former senators must wait twice as long. Many, however, are able to work around those requirements at firms by signing on as consultants, counsel and strategic advisors, as a recent analysis by CRP and the Sunlight Foundation shows. That study’s conclusion: “The many loopholes limiting who can lobby whom in Washington and whether that lobbying must be disclosed to the public make a hunk of Swiss cheese look like the Berlin Wall.” (Read more about the congressmen who joined lobbying firms HERE)

Children Were Hunted Down and Killed Trying to Escape ‘Rape Dungeon’ in Florida [+video]

Photo Credit: Latest Researchers have released chilling details about a Florida reform school for boys this week, including evidence of ‘rape dungeons’ that were used to abuse and murder children, the Daily News reports.

Anthropologists from the University of South Florida are beginning to uncover the disturbing stories of children who were abused and murdered at Arthur G. Dozier School in Marianna. The researchers have found the remains of 51 individuals, along with other materials, such as syringes, drug bottles and even a water cooler holding a dead dog buried in the cemetery next to the school.

In an attempt to uncover as much of the story as possible, university researchers are going through old records, newspaper articles and interviewing families to try to piece together the school’s painful past . . .

Researchers say the school did not report every death that occurred and did not submit death certificates in many cases. In their interviews with former inmates and school employees, they also learned of the ‘rape dungeon’ where young boys were sexually assaulted by those charged to care for them.

Some of the boys were murdered after they tried to escape the school. Robert Hewitt escaped in 1960 and hid in his family’s house near the school. Relatives came home one day to find the boy had been shot dead with his father’s shotgun, which was lying across his body. (Read more about the uncovered ‘rape dungeon’ HERE)

Boy in Coma Starts Breathing After Doctors Insist He Was Brain Dead

By Kirsten Anderson. A 12-year-old Texas boy who slipped into a coma after suffering a severe asthma attack has begun breathing on his own – just hours after hospital officials fought to take him off life support because they believed he was legally “brain dead.” Now, his family has obtained a court order requiring the hospital to provide nourishment to the boy via a feeding tube, and hope to have him transferred to another facility within the week.

Joey Cronin has been at Driscoll Children’s Hospital in Corpus Christi since January 14, when he suffered cardiac arrest as a result of an asthma attack. In an interview last week with LifeSiteNews, Joey’s father George Cronin said that hospital staff were pessimistic about his chances of recovery from the very start, even though early on, Joey was showing signs of awareness – opening his eyes, gripping his parents’ hands, and responding to external stimuli.

“They were very negative,” Cronin told LifeSiteNews last week. “On the night he came in, they told me it could be a matter of hours before they would have to [remove Joey from life support].” However, the testing the hospital did to prove Joey was brain dead showed he was responsive, so they were forced to honor the Cronins’ wishes to keep the boy on his ventilator. But they refused to install a feeding tube so that he could receive nutrition.

When Joey slipped into a coma several days later, the hospital became more aggressive in its push to have the boy declared brain dead – the legal threshold for issuing a death certificate in Texas. With a death certificate, the hospital could remove Joey from life support against his parents’ wishes. Under advice from a local attorney, the Cronins refused to give consent for any further testing. They then sought help from Alliance Defending Freedom, a Christian legal defense group. Their only goal was to force the hospital to keep Joey alive until he could be transferred safely to another hospital – one that would give him lifesaving treatment without giving up on him.

At least one facility in Houston had already agreed to take Joey in, and another in New Jersey was open to the possibility. But the biggest question in the Cronins’ mind was whether Driscoll Children’s would give Joey the care he needed to stay strong enough for transfer. They reached out via news and social media, begging people to contact the hospital to urge them not to give up on Joey’s care. (Read more from this story HERE)

Head of Tampa Down Syndrome Charity Embezzled $100,000 For Personal Use

By Mike Brassfield. Every October for 10 years, the Down Syndrome Network of Tampa Bay held a “Buddy Walk,” a fundraiser in a local park featuring a mile-long walk, games, clowns, giveaways, food and raffles. It raised tens of thousands of dollars — purportedly to fund programs for children with Down syndrome.

But last October, the Buddy Walk was canceled.

“We have had a problem with our nonprofit status,” the charity’s website announced. “This event is near and dear to our hearts, but is not possible this year.”

The unspoken reason: The charity’s founder and president was being investigated by police and was facing hard questions from some of the group’s members.

On Friday, she was arrested on charges that she embezzled more than $100,000 in charitable donations for her own use. Shirley Lawyer, 53, of Largo was charged with grand theft and was booked into the Pinellas County Jail. (Read more from this story HERE)
